Joining the Secret Service, Office of Investigations, Forensic Services Division will allow you to perform evidence enterprise systems activities in support of financial fraud and protective operations investigations. Your work in developing and maintaining evidence enterprise systems and databases will aid the agency's goals by facilitating collaboration on criminal investigations. Duties

The selectee will serve as a/an Evidence Systems Specialist (Forensic) in the Forensic Services Division. Typical work assignments include: Arranging the handling, processing, reporting and storage of notes, documents, and evidence. Reviewing information and evidence across sources to identify and address any inconsistencies or inaccuracies. Participating in audits and evaluations of evidence enterprise reporting operations and their effectiveness. Providing guidance to stakeholders regarding relevant initiatives, best practices, and industry standards. Collaborating with Federal, state and other law enforcement agencies to exchange information related to evidence enterprise activities.

Qualifications

Applicants must demonstrate that they meet the Minimum Qualification/Specialized Experience requirements as noted below. Minimum Qualifications: You qualify for the GS-9 level (starting salary $64,957.00) if you possess one of the following: GS-9: Applicant must demonstrate one full year of specialized experience comparable in scope and responsibility to the GS-7 level in the Federal service (obtained in either the public or private sectors) performing the following duties: Assisting in the secure processing, handling and/or storage of evidence; Disseminating information to the appropriate contacts according to security protocols; and Utilizing software and applicable equipment to assist in processing evidence. OR Successful completion of a Master's or equivalent graduate degree; or two (2) full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ree; or LL.B. or J.D., if related, at an accredited college or university in a field that provided the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to perform this work. OR Have a combination of specialized experience (less than one year) and graduate education (less than two years) that when combined equals 100% of the qualification requirement. Note: Only graduate education in excess of one year (generally 18 semester hours) may be used in this calculation. Minimum Qualifications: You qualify for the GS-11 level (starting salary $78,592.00) if you possess one of the following: GS-11: Applicant must demonstrate one full year of specialized experience comparable in scope and responsibility to the GS-9 level in the Federal service (obtained in either the public or private sectors) performing the following duties: Utilizing automated evidence systems to support the analysis of routine systems evidence; Researching technical information to provide analytics reports to senior specialists; and Working within a team to resolve evidence systems issues in compliance with set processes, procedures and/or industry standards. OR Successful completion of a PhD. or equivalent doctoral degree; or three (3) years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to a Ph.D. or equivalent degree, e.g., LL.M., if related, at an accredited college or university in a field that provided the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to perform this work. OR Have a combination of specialized experience (less than one year) and graduate education (less than three years) that when combined equals 100% of the qualification requirement. Note: Only graduate education in excess of one year (generally 36 semester hours) may be used in this calculation. NOTE: You must submit a copy of your college transcripts (official or unofficial) and your resume must explicitly indicate how you meet the experience, otherwise you will be found ineligible. All qualification requirements must be met by the closing date of this announcement. Qualification claims will be subject to verification.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community, student, social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.
